Limassol: Driver trapped after road accident – Vehicle falls into ditch

A road accident occurred on Tuesday afternoon on the Akrounta–Dierona road, in the Limassol district, prompting a response from the Fire Service after a vehicle lost control and came to rest in a ditch.

Emergency response at 12:39

According to the Fire Service, authorities received the call at 12:39 and the Agios Nikolaos Fire Station responded with a vehicle and a rescue team.

The incident involved a driver who lost control of the vehicle, causing it to veer off the road and end up on its side inside a roadside ditch.

Rescue operation at the scene

Firefighters carried out a rescue operation and safely extricated the driver from the vehicle using rescue equipment.

The driver was then transported by a relative to Limassol General Hospital for medical examinations.

The road accident caused a brief mobilisation of emergency services, with responders securing the scene and assisting the injured driver.

Investigation underway

Authorities are investigating the causes of the road accident.

No further details regarding the driver’s condition have been released at this stage.
